The celestial equator is the great circle of the imaginary celestial sphere on the same plane as the equator of a planet, by convention generally Earth. By extension, it is also a plane of reference in the equatorial coordinate system. Because of the Earth's axial tilt, the celestial equator is currently inclined by about 23.44° with respect to the…
